Two print charges $$ q_1 = +2.40 n C $$ and $$ q_2 = -6.50 nC $$ are 0.100 m apart. Point A is midway between them ; point B is 0.080 m form $$q_1 $$ and 0.060 m from $$ q_2 $$ as shown in fig. take the electric potential to be zero at infinity .
The potential at point A is

A
-120 V
B
-323 V
C
-705 V
D
-738 V
Solution
Verified by Toppr

Correct option is A. -738 V
Electric Potential:
At $$ A : V_A = k ( \dfrac {q_1}{r_1} + \dfrac {q_2}{r_2})= k( \dfrac { 2.40 \times 10^{-9} C }{ 0.05 m } + \dfrac { -6.50 \times 10^{-9} C} {0.05 m } ) = -738 V $$
